INGREDIENTS
4 lbs of chicken wings (frozen)
2 cups of Honey BBQ Sauce (some for basting too)
SIDES:
celery
baby carrots
cucumber
ranch dressing or blue cheese
DIRECTIONS
In the CROCK POT pour in the FROZEN chicken wings. Cook on low for 2 hours. Next, pour out the juice that has render from the chicken wings and pour in 2 cups of the HONEY BBQ sauce. Stir and COOK on LOW for another 2 hours.
While you are waiting for the chicken wings to be done…WRAP a baking pan with FOIL and set ASIDE.
Once the CHICKEN WINGS are done…take them out of the crockpot and place them onto your prepared baking pan. Bast them and turn the OVEN to broil and broiled them for a few minutes (KEEP A CLOSE EYE on them). Remove them from the oven and turn each wing to the other side and bast them again and place them back into the oven for a few more minutes. SERVE them with ranch dressing or blue cheese. My family loves to eat them with baby carrots, celery sticks, and cucumber. ENJOY!!!
